What Alternative Dispute Resolution process do drinks companies typically use in distribution agreements, and how is it structured?

Rather than a single industry-standard ADR service, drinks distributors and suppliers typically negotiate the dispute resolution framework as part of the agreement itself. **Jurisdiction and governing law are agreed upfront** — commonly either the Netherlands or UK for European deals — and then the specific resolution service or representatives are only determined if an actual dispute arises. Members emphasise that the key is to clarify in advance which legal jurisdiction will apply; the actual ADR mechanism (mediation, arbitration, etc.) can be left flexible and agreed between parties only if needed, which avoids locking into a costly process that hopefully won't be required.
